What is the purpose of classes in Microsoft.Practices.CompositeWeb.Web

Topics: Web Client Software Factory, User Forum
Feb 22, 2007 at 5:35 PM
I see the implementation classes HttpContext, HttpServerUtility , HttpSessionState etc in Microsoft.Practices.CompositeWeb.Web namespace implementing SYstem.web interfaces . What is the purpose of these implementations ?. Use them from Test (as mock implementations) may be ?

Feb 22, 2007 at 6:33 PM
These classes allowed us to isolate the code we were writing from the ASP.NET infrastructure enough that we could unit test our code. Some of them got more use than others during the evolution of the codebase.